
Thirteen Doorways: Wolves behind Them All
Laura Ruby
Set in 1941, this novel brings together two young women, one living and one dead, during World War II. Frankie and her sister live in a Chicago orphanage after their mother’s death and their father’s departure. The nuns running the institution subject the girls to cruelty. At the same orphanage, a ghost seeks closure. Loss, desire, and the vulnerability of the American dream shape the parallel lives.
